b Slide Show Press the c button (playback mode) M d button (A8) M b Slide show Play back images one by one in an automated "slide show." When movie files (A90) are played back in the slide show, only the first frame of each movie is displayed. 1 Use the multi selector HI to select Start and press the k button. Slide show Pause • The slide show begins. Start • To change the interval between images, Frame intvl 3s select Frame intvl, press the k button, Loop and specify the desired interval time before selecting Start. • To repeat the slide show automatically, select Loop and press the k button before selecting Start. • The maximum playback time is up to about 30 minutes even if Loop is enabled. 2 Select End or Restart. • The screen shown on the right is displayed after the slide show ends or is paused. To exit the show, select G and then press the k button. To resume the slide show, select F and then press the k button. Operations During Playback • Use JK to display the previous/next image. Press and hold to rewind/fast forward. • Press the k button to pause or end the slide show. Reference Section E54
